    "Onshore Canning Basin joint venturers include; a) Buru Energy - Mitsubishi; b) New Standard Energy - Conoco Phillips; c) Hess - Kingsway Oil; and d) AWE - Nonruest.

    The Canning Basin is also estimated to hold light crude and condensate oils with technically recoverable oil reserves of 9.8 Bbbl. Once gas is harnessed, then Buru's oil production is expected to be increased further with the extraction of condensate from 'wet gas'. Production of large quantities of gas sufficient to support an LNG export operation from the onshore Canning Basin could potentially commence within the foreseeable future. This might entail a network of oil and gas pipelines to link the onshore Canning Basin with one or more export ports, and/or with the Pilbara end of the Port Hedland to Bunbury domestic gas pipeline."
